For the 2025 school year, there are 10 public elementary schools serving 2,968 students in Lakewood, OH.
The top ranked public elementary schools in Lakewood, OH are Lincoln Elementary School, Grant Elementary School and Harding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Lakewood, OH public elementary schools have an average math proficiency score of 71% (versus the Ohio public elementary school average of 54%), and reading proficiency score of 74% (versus the 59% statewide average). Elementary schools in Lakewood have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Ohio public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 26%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is less than the Ohio public elementary school average of 35% (majority Black).
